Output 8118f0e5b98db30bb9ca23b57ea2aca46010c9f9c88bd1e6c1dbceed0aa42f59:25

value
38407592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44dbca269c48f10fa5dfcda081f857bc9e2f5260 OP_EQUAL
address
37y7AqjBXfWZKvAmgV7ax68iW42Buu8rTa
transaction
8118f0e5b98db30bb9ca23b57ea2aca46010c9f9c88bd1e6c1dbceed0aa42f59
confirmations
523596
spent
true